Scores from Nov. 11 – 18

  • Varsity football won against the Flower Mound Marcus Marauders for the bi-district round of the play-offs at Flower Mound, Friday, Nov. 12, 28-21.
  • Varsity girl’s golf competed in a tournament Friday, Nov. 12, at Texarkana Country Club and placed second.
  • Varsity girl’s wrestling had a fourth-place finisher, second-place finisher and a champion at their Arlington Invitational meet Friday, Nov. 12.
  • Varsity boy’s wrestling had 2 fourth-place finishers, 3 second-place finishers and two champions at the Arlington Invitational, Saturday, Nov. 13.
  • Varsity boy’s basketball lost against Frisco Liberty, Saturday, Nov. 13, in their first regular-season game, 69-61.

Highlights

  • Varsity boy’s wrestling’s Mason Gordon and Joseph Richardson were named boys champions at their meet.
  • Varsity girl’s wrestling’s Sarah Benavides and Ciera Stuver were named girls champions at their meet.
  • All three girl’s basketball teams won their games, Tuesday, Nov. 16.
